Arctic expedition on hold due to ban on Russian collaborations

Swedish scientists told to stay at home next year following government's moratorium on joint projects

A Swedish-led Arctic expedition, planned for 2023, has been put on hold because it would have been carried out in cooperation with Russian researchers, Stockholm University has announced.

Last month, the Swedish government introduced a moratorium against programme-level collaboration with Russian universities and research institutes in protest at Russia’s invasion of Ukraine. Stockholm University said it supports the sanctions, but Örjan Gustafsson, a professor at Stockholm’s department for environmental science, warned that there might be a negative impact on climate research in the Arctic.
